12 ounce bottle into chalice, no bottle dating (presumed to be last years batch with the older label). Pours cloudy golden orange color with a small off white head with decent retention, that reduces to a thin cap that lingers. Some minimal spotty lacing on the glass. Aromas of orange, apricot, pepper, herbal, clove, banana, amber candi sugar, caramel, biscuit, molasses, and yeast spices. Some pretty good aromas with good balance, complexity, and decent strength. Taste of biscuit, orange, apricot, raisin, candi sugar, banana, toffee, herbal, clove, light pepper, toast, bubblegum, and yeast spices. Lingering notes of citrus, candi sugar, biscuit, clove, pepper, toffee, and toast for a good bit. More of a malty tripel than most of the style; but there is great flavor balance and absolutely no cloying sweetness. Medium carbonation and medium-full bodied; with a fairly creamy and slightly slick mouthfeel that is very nice. Very smooth to sip; with no alcohol warming noticed other than a slight warming after the finish. Overall this is a really nice tripel. Despite the fact I like spicier tripels; the flavor complexity and balance was pretty much spot on. Really enjoyable stuff!
